Поделиться через


ServiceUnits class

Класс, представляющий ServiceUnits.

Конструкторы

ServiceUnits(AzureDeploymentManagerContext)

Создайте ServiceUnits.

Методы

beginCreateOrUpdate(string, string, string, string, ServiceUnitResource, RequestOptionsBase)

Это асинхронная операция и можно провести опрос до завершения с помощью ресурса операции, возвращаемого этой операцией.

createOrUpdate(string, string, string, string, ServiceUnitResource, RequestOptionsBase)

Это асинхронная операция и можно провести опрос до завершения с помощью ресурса операции, возвращаемого этой операцией.

deleteMethod(string, string, string, string, RequestOptionsBase)
deleteMethod(string, string, string, string, RequestOptionsBase, ServiceCallback<void>)
deleteMethod(string, string, string, string, ServiceCallback<void>)
get(string, string, string, string, RequestOptionsBase)
get(string, string, string, string, RequestOptionsBase, ServiceCallback<ServiceUnitResource>)
get(string, string, string, string, ServiceCallback<ServiceUnitResource>)
list(string, string, string, RequestOptionsBase)
list(string, string, string, RequestOptionsBase, ServiceCallback<ServiceUnitResource[]>)
list(string, string, string, ServiceCallback<ServiceUnitResource[]>)

Сведения о конструкторе

ServiceUnits(AzureDeploymentManagerContext)

Создайте ServiceUnits.

new ServiceUnits(client: AzureDeploymentManagerContext)

Параметры

client
AzureDeploymentManagerContext

Ссылка на клиент службы.

Сведения о методе

beginCreateOrUpdate(string, string, string, string, ServiceUnitResource, RequestOptionsBase)

Это асинхронная операция и можно провести опрос до завершения с помощью ресурса операции, возвращаемого этой операцией.

function beginCreateOrUpdate(resourceGroupName: string, serviceTopologyName: string, serviceName: string, serviceUnitName: string, serviceUnitInfo: ServiceUnitResource, options?: RequestOptionsBase): Promise<LROPoller>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

serviceUnitName

string

Имя ресурса единицы обслуживания.

serviceUnitInfo
ServiceUnitResource

Объект ресурса единицы обслуживания.

options
RequestOptionsBase

Необязательные параметры

Возвращаемое значение

Promise<@azure/ms-rest-azure-js.LROPoller>

Обещание<msRestAzure.LROPoller>

createOrUpdate(string, string, string, string, ServiceUnitResource, RequestOptionsBase)

Это асинхронная операция и можно провести опрос до завершения с помощью ресурса операции, возвращаемого этой операцией.

function createOrUpdate(resourceGroupName: string, serviceTopologyName: string, serviceName: string, serviceUnitName: string, serviceUnitInfo: ServiceUnitResource, options?: RequestOptionsBase): Promise<ServiceUnitsCreateOrUpdateRes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

serviceUnitName

string

Имя ресурса единицы обслуживания.

serviceUnitInfo
ServiceUnitResource

Объект ресурса единицы обслуживания.

options
RequestOptionsBase

Необязательные параметры

Возвращаемое значение

Обещание<Models.ServiceUnitsCreateOrUpdateResponse>

deleteMethod(string, string, string, string, RequestOptionsBase)

function deleteMethod(resourceGroupName: string, serviceTopologyName: string, serviceName: string, serviceUnitName: string, options?: RequestOptionsBase): Promise<RestRes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

serviceUnitName

string

Имя ресурса единицы обслуживания.

options
RequestOptionsBase

Необязательные параметры

Возвращаемое значение

Promise<RestResponse>

Обещание<msRest.RestResponse>

deleteMethod(string, string, string, string, RequestOptionsBase, ServiceCallback<void>)

function deleteMethod(resourceGroupName: string, serviceTopologyName: string, serviceName: string, serviceUnitName: string, options: RequestOptionsBase,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

serviceUnitName

string

Имя ресурса единицы обслуживания.

options
RequestOptionsBase

Необязательные параметры

callback

ServiceCallback<void>

Обратный вызов

deleteMethod(string, string, string, string, ServiceCallback<void>)

function deleteMethod(resourceGroupName: string, serviceTopologyName: string, serviceName: string, serviceUnitName: string,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

serviceUnitName

string

Имя ресурса единицы обслуживания.

callback

ServiceCallback<void>

Обратный вызов

get(string, string, string, string, RequestOptionsBase)

function get(resourceGroupName: string, serviceTopologyName: string, serviceName: string, serviceUnitName: string, options?: RequestOptionsBase): Promise<ServiceUnitsGetRes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

serviceUnitName

string

Имя ресурса единицы обслуживания.

options
RequestOptionsBase

Необязательные параметры

Возвращаемое значение

Обещание<Models.ServiceUnitsGetResponse>

get(string, string, string, string, RequestOptionsBase, ServiceCallback<ServiceUnitResource>)

function get(resourceGroupName: string, serviceTopologyName: string, serviceName: string, serviceUnitName: string, options: RequestOptionsBase, callback: ServiceCallback<ServiceUnitResource>)

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

serviceUnitName

string

Имя ресурса единицы обслуживания.

options
RequestOptionsBase

Необязательные параметры

callback

ServiceCallback<ServiceUnitResource>

Обратный вызов

get(string, string, string, string, ServiceCallback<ServiceUnitResource>)

function get(resourceGroupName: string, serviceTopologyName: string, serviceName: string, serviceUnitName: string, callback: ServiceCallback<ServiceUnitResource>)

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

serviceUnitName

string

Имя ресурса единицы обслуживания.

callback

ServiceCallback<ServiceUnitResource>

Обратный вызов

list(string, string, string, RequestOptionsBase)

function list(resourceGroupName: string, serviceTopologyName: string, serviceName: string, options?: RequestOptionsBase): Promise<ServiceUnitsListRes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

options
RequestOptionsBase

Необязательные параметры

Возвращаемое значение

Обещание<Models.ServiceUnitsListResponse>

list(string, string, string, RequestOptionsBase, ServiceCallback<ServiceUnitResource[]>)

function list(resourceGroupName: string, serviceTopologyName: string, serviceName: string, options: RequestOptionsBase, callback: ServiceCallback<ServiceUnitResource[]>)

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

options
RequestOptionsBase

Необязательные параметры

callback

ServiceCallback<ServiceUnitResource[]>

Обратный вызов

list(string, string, string, ServiceCallback<ServiceUnitResource[]>)

function list(resourceGroupName: string, serviceTopologyName: string, serviceName: string, callback: ServiceCallback<ServiceUnitResource[]>)

Параметры

resourceGroupName

string

Имя группы ресурсов. Имя не учитывает регистр.

serviceTopologyName

string

Имя топологии службы.

serviceName

string

Имя ресурса службы.

callback

ServiceCallback<ServiceUnitResource[]>

Обратный вызов